Located 17 miles east of downtown San Diego, El Cajon combines suburban comfort with metropolitan convenience. This welcoming city offers various housing options, from apartment communities to single-family homes, with current rental rates averaging $1,725 for one-bedroom units and $2,057 for two bedrooms. Fletcher Hills and Rancho San Diego feature scenic views and convenient access to Parkway Plaza shopping center. The Water Conservation Garden and Butterfly Garden at Cuyamaca College provide peaceful outdoor spaces for residents to explore.
El Cajon's community spirit shines through its local businesses and cultural celebrations. The city is home to Taylor Guitars, a globally recognized manufacturer of premium acoustic and electric guitars. Community events like America on Main Street and the historic Mother Goose Parade, a beloved tradition since 1946, bring residents together each year. The area serves educational needs through Grossmont College and Cuyamaca College.
